Lancaster County Sheriff’s Deputy Earns Promotion
The Lancaster County Sheriff’s Office has promoted Deputy Investigator Joanna Dimas to the rank of Sergeant. Lancaster County Sheriff Terry Wagner says Sergeant Dimas will now serve in the Patrol Division, which provides around-the-clock law enforcement services across Lancaster County. Bomb threat at southeast Lincoln church prompts police response; no danger found
LINCOLN, Neb. (KOLN) - The Lincoln Police Department responded to a possible bomb threat on Friday just after 9 a.m. at College View Church. Officers responded to the scene near S. 48th Street and Prescott Avenue, briefly blocking off the area for an investigation. Federal, state and local partners worked...
